Frequently Asked Questions About International ProStar Windshield Wiper & Roof Accessories

Will these wiper blades fit my 2008-2017 International ProStar, and what sizes do I need?

Most International ProStar models from 2008-2017 use 24-inch wiper blades for both driver and passenger sides. However, some later models (2016-2017) may require 26-inch blades. Always verify your specific model year before ordering. The mounting system typically uses a J-hook or pin-type connection, which is standard across most ProStar models. Check your existing blade attachment type to ensure compatibility.

How difficult is it to install aftermarket wiper arms and motors on a ProStar?

Installing wiper arms is relatively straightforward and takes about 15-30 minutes with basic tools. Simply lift the old arm away from the windshield, remove the retaining nut (typically 13mm or 15mm), and pull the arm off the splined shaft. Wiper motor replacement is more involved, requiring removal of the cowl panel and potentially the wiper transmission linkage. Most installations require a socket set, screwdrivers, and possibly trim removal tools. Professional installation typically runs $75-150 if you prefer not to DIY.

What material and finish options are available for ProStar windshield accessories?

Wiper arms typically come in black powder-coated steel or stainless steel finishes. Stainless steel options resist corrosion better and maintain appearance longer, especially in harsh weather conditions. For decorative trim and accent pieces, you'll find chrome-plated ABS plastic, polished stainless steel, and black powder-coated options. Chrome plastic is more affordable but may show wear after 2-3 years, while stainless steel options typically last 5+ years with minimal maintenance.

Why do my ProStar wipers streak or chatter, even with new blades?

Streaking and chattering often indicate worn wiper arms rather than just bad blades. Check for bent arms, worn pivot points, or weak spring tension. The wiper arm spring should maintain 15-20 pounds of pressure on the windshield. Also inspect the windshield for pitting or mineral deposits that can cause poor wiper performance. Using a glass treatment product like Rain-X can help, but ensure it's compatible with your wiper blade material to avoid premature wear.

Are there any specific roof accessories that help with ProStar windshield visibility?

Sun visors and cab extenders can significantly reduce glare and rain accumulation on your windshield. External sun visors for ProStar models typically mount using existing holes above the windshield and extend 5-7 inches. Cab roof fairings and extenders help direct airflow over the windshield, reducing bug splatter and rain accumulation at highway speeds. Most require drilling 4-6 mounting holes and include templates for proper placement. These accessories can improve visibility by up to 30% in adverse conditions.
